| Plant type: evergreen soft-wooded perennial Hardiness zones: 9b-12 Sunlight: hot overhead sun to warm low sun Soil Moisture: aquatic Soil: no soil, mildly acidic to neutral Tolerances: light frost |

Origins: Australia, NT, North Africa, Tropical Africa, Southern Africa, Indian Ocean Islands, India-Subcontinent, China-Korea-Taiwan, Tropical Asia, Pacific Islands, USA, Mexico, Central America, Caribbean, South America Other Botanical Names: Apiospermum obcordatum, Limnonesis commutata, L. friedrichsthaliana, Pistia aegyptiaca, P. aethiopica, P. africana, P. amazonica, P. brasiliensis, P. commutata, P. crispata, P. cumingii, P. gardneri, P. horkeliana, P. leprieuri, P. linguiformis, P. m Other Common Names: Nile Cabbage, Shell Flower | ||||||||
